This patch is V2 of the Emma Mobile GPIO driver. This
driver is designed to be reusable between multiple SoCs
that share the same basic building block, but so far it
has only been used on Emma Mobile EV2.

Each driver instance handles 32 GPIOs with individually
maskable IRQs. The driver operates on two I/O memory
ranges and the 32 GPIOs are hooked up to two interrupts.

In the case of Emma Mobile EV2 this GPIO building block
is used as main external interrupt controller hooking up
159 GPIOS as 159 interrupts via 5 driver instances and
10 interrupts to the GIC and the Cortex-A9 Dual.

Changes since V1:
- use inline for private data functions using container_of()
- use BIT(n) instead of 1 << n
- added legacy irq domain support for static mappings
- use irqd_to_hwirq() instead of own offset calculation
- convert irqchip callbacks to not care about virq
- rework IRQ handler to read interrupt status inside loop

Changes not made:
- ioread/iowrite are still used over readl/writel
- no request_mem_region
- no devm_ alloc/ioremap
- kept the kconfig dependencies as in V1

+static int em_gio_irq_set_type(struct irq_data *d, unsigned int type)
+{
+ unsigned char value = em_gio_sense_table[type & IRQ_TYPE_SENSE_MASK];
+ struct em_gio_priv *p = irq_to_priv(d);
+ unsigned int reg, offset, shift;
+ unsigned long flags;
+ unsigned long tmp;
+
+ if (!value)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 offset = irqd_to_hwirq(d);
+
+ pr_debug("gio: sense irq = %d, mode = %d\n", offset, value);
+
+ /* 8 x 4 bit fields in 4 IDT registers */
+ reg = GIO_IDT(offset >> 3);
+ shift = (offset & 0x07) << 4;
+
+ spin_lock_irqsave(&p->sense_lock, flags);
+
+ /* disable the interrupt in IIA */
+ tmp = em_gio_read(p, GIO_IIA);
+ tmp &= ~BIT(offset);
+ em_gio_write(p, GIO_IIA, tmp);
+
+ /* change the sense setting in IDT */
+ tmp = em_gio_read(p, reg);
+ tmp &= ~(0xf << shift);
+ tmp |= value << shift;
+ em_gio_write(p, reg, tmp);
+
+ /* clear pending interrupts */
+ em_gio_write(p, GIO_IIR, BIT(offset));
+
+ /* enable the interrupt in IIA */
+ tmp = em_gio_read(p, GIO_IIA);
+ tmp |= BIT(offset);
+ em_gio_write(p, GIO_IIA, tmp);
+
+ spin_unlock_irqrestore(&p->sense_lock, flags);
+
+ return 0;
+}
